Though there are hundreds of clothing categories, Indian sarees are well-known for its exquisite designs and varieties. As India is a country with diverse cultures and religions co-existing together, so are its outfits that differ in style and wearing pattern from state to state. Even though more and more people are preferring western outfits, Indian saree still rules the show with the distinct change it brings in the beauty of the woman adorning it.

There are different styles of sarees popularly worn across India such as : Chanderi, Maheshwari, Kosa silk in Central style; Muslin, Rajshahi, Tussar silk in Eastern style; Bandhani, Kota doria, Patola in Western style; Mysore, Kanchipuram in Southern style; and Banarasi in Northern style. Indeed, buying Indian sarees online has many advantages but how one could be sure of the quality of the material? Since people prefer quality with price therefore trust is a big factor with online Indian sarees. With so many e-commerce sites coming up everyday, it becomes difficult to trust the quality of the items they deliver. However there are two ways in which you can put some trust over online sellers i.e. offline and online. Offline refers to ask your friends or family members, which site they trust, and online includes reading reviews of other customers. Ratings and reviews posted by other purchasers will help you in assessing the quality of the material. To be on safe side, it is important to select the right shop. A simple search on many search engines will give you multiple results and it is up to you to go through a few of the top shops and check the reviews.
